Route 2: Parma, OH

April 23rd, 2009

Well what can we say about the second stop in Ohio? Better weather? New group? The number of adoptions? We would have to say all of the above. It was a bright sunny day with a very light breeze, a good start to a promising partnership with the Northeast Ohio SPCA. This was this group’s first time working on the Tour For Life.

When we arrived at the shelter they came out and greeted us with open arms. We parked right in front of the shelter, set everything thing up and loaded a bunch of puppies on our Rescue Unit. The shelter was open for a little while before we got there and were already processing adoptions. They had rescued some puppies and dogs from Tennessee that needed to be rescued.

The day was nonstop all day. From the time we placed puppies on the unit to the end of the event, we couldn’t keep the puppies in the cages for very long. Every time we cleaned out a cage there was another puppy to be placed in it. Most of the adult dogs were kept in the shelter, but throughout the day we saw them being walked by potential adopters. A great sight.

By the end of the day there we were all amazed at the number of adoptions. A grand total of 42 adoptions. Someone said this was a new record set for a single day of adoptions. What an inaugural event for the Northeast Ohio SPCA. We hope this becomes a permanent stop on the Tour For Life.

Well one more stop on Route 2 in Syracuse and then back home just in time for Pet Adoptathon.
